Psalm 110
Smith's Literal Translation Par ▾ 

God’s Faithful Messiah
(Genesis 14:17–24; Hebrews 5:1–10)

1To David a chanting. Jehovah spake to my Lord, Sit thou at my right hand and I will set thine enemies the stool to thy feet.

2The rod of thy strength will Jehovah send out of Zion: rule thou in the midst of thine enemies.

3Thy people were willing in the day of thy strength, in the splendors of holiness from the womb of the dawn: to thee the dew of thy childhood.

4Jehovah sware and he will not lament, Thou a priest forever according to the manner of Melchizedeck.

5Jehovah upon thy right hand crushed kings in the day of his anger.

6He shall judge in the nations; he filled with dead bodies: he crushed the head over much land.

7He shall drink from the torrent in the way: for this he shall lift up the head.
